shingles
vaccine is now free on Medicare Part D.Before the Inflation Reduction Act, you could have spent hundreds of dollars on Shingrix even with a Part D prescription drug plan. But starting in 2023, 100% of your costs of all adult vaccines, including shingles, are covered by Medicare.
